Understand Connecticut’s Basic Insurance Requirements
Before selecting a policy, it is important to understand what Connecticut requires. Like other states, Connecticut mandates minimum auto liability coverage. Liability insurance helps pay for injuries or property damage you cause to others in an accident. However, state minimums often provide only limited protection. If you are involved in a serious accident, minimum coverage may not be enough to cover all expenses.
That is why many drivers seeking Auto Insurance Waterford CT choose limits above the legal minimum. Higher liability limits can offer better financial security, especially if you have savings, a home, or other assets to protect. In addition to liability, you may also want to consider collision, comprehensive, uninsured/underinsured motorist coverage, and medical payments coverage.
Evaluate Your Personal Driving Needs
No two drivers need exactly the same type of insurance. Your ideal Car Insurance Waterford CT policy should reflect your vehicle, driving habits, budget, and risk tolerance.
Here are a few factors to consider:
- How often you drive
- The age and value of your car
- Whether you lease or finance your vehicle
- Your driving record
- The number of drivers in your household
- Whether you have a teen driver on the policy
For example, if you drive a newer vehicle, collision and comprehensive coverage are usually worth serious consideration. If your car is older and has a lower market value, you may decide that carrying full coverage is less cost-effective. Compare More Than Just Price
When shopping for Insurance Quotes Waterford CT, many consumers focus first on the monthly premium. While understandable, premium alone does not tell the full story. A lower premium may come with:
- Higher deductibles
- Lower liability limits
- Fewer optional protections
- Limited claims support
- Restrictions on repair options
Instead of comparing policies by cost only, review the entire package. Ask what happens if your vehicle is totaled, stolen, vandalized, or damaged in a storm. Find out whether rental reimbursement, roadside assistance, and gap coverage are available. These details can make a major Insurance agency difference after an accident.

Review Your Coverage Regularly
Your insurance needs can change over time. A policy that was right for you three years ago may no longer be the best fit today. Major life events often affect your coverage needs, including:
- Buying or selling a car
- Moving to a new address
- Getting married
- Adding a teen driver
- Improving your credit profile
- Starting a business
- Buying a home or signing a new lease

Ask the Right Questions Before You Buy
A good insurance decision starts with good questions. Before you commit to a policy, ask:
- What exactly is covered?
- What are the deductibles?
- Are there exclusions or limitations?
- How does the claims process work?
- Are discounts available for safe driving, bundling, or vehicle safety features?
- Will my rates change after a claim?
